异构数据可视化技术,是一种将来自不同来源、格式和类型的数据进行统一展示的方法。这种技术能够有效地整合、分析和展示数据,使得用户可以更直观地理解和利用数据。异构数据可视化技术的核心在于数据整合、数据转换、数据展示。数据整合是指将来自不同系统的数据进行收集和存储;数据转换是指将不同格式的数据进行标准化处理,使其能够被统一分析;数据展示则是指通过图表、仪表盘等方式将处理后的数据呈现给用户。数据展示是其中最为关键的一环,因为只有通过有效的可视化,用户才能真正理解和利用数据。
一、数据整合
数据整合是异构数据可视化技术的第一步,也是最为基础的一步。数据整合包括数据收集和数据存储两个部分。数据收集是指从不同的数据源中获取数据,这些数据源可以是关系型数据库、非关系型数据库、文件系统、API接口等。数据存储是指将收集到的数据进行存储,这通常需要一个统一的数据仓库或者数据湖。
在数据整合的过程中,面临的最大挑战是数据的多样性和分散性。不同的数据源可能使用不同的数据模型和存储格式,这给数据的收集和存储带来了很大的困难。例如,一个系统可能使用关系型数据库来存储数据,而另一个系统则可能使用NoSQL数据库。此外,还有一些数据可能存储在文件系统中,甚至是通过API接口提供的实时数据。
为了应对这些挑战,通常会使用ETL(Extract, Transform, Load)工具来进行数据整合。ETL工具可以从不同的数据源中抽取数据,对数据进行转换和清洗,然后将数据加载到一个统一的数据仓库中。通过这种方式,可以实现对异构数据的有效整合。
二、数据转换
数据转换是异构数据可视化技术的第二步,也是关键的一步。数据转换包括数据清洗、数据标准化和数据转换三个部分。数据清洗是指对数据进行清理,去除重复数据、错误数据和无效数据;数据标准化是指将不同格式的数据进行统一,使其符合某种标准;数据转换是指将数据转换成可视化工具可以处理的格式。
在数据转换的过程中,数据清洗是最为基础的一步。数据清洗可以通过编写脚本或者使用专业的清洗工具来实现。数据清洗的目的是去除数据中的噪音和错误,使数据更加准确和可靠。
数据标准化是数据转换的核心步骤。数据标准化的目的是将不同格式的数据进行统一,使其符合某种标准。例如,不同的数据源可能使用不同的日期格式,一个系统可能使用"YYYY-MM-DD"格式,而另一个系统可能使用"MM/DD/YYYY"格式。通过数据标准化,可以将这些不同格式的数据统一转换成一种标准格式。
数据转换是数据转换的最后一步。数据转换的目的是将数据转换成可视化工具可以处理的格式。例如,FineBI、FineReport、FineVis等可视化工具可能需要数据以特定的格式进行输入。通过数据转换,可以将数据转换成这些工具所需的格式,从而实现数据的可视化。
三、数据展示
数据展示是异构数据可视化技术的最后一步,也是最为重要的一步。数据展示包括数据的可视化设计和数据的可视化呈现两个部分。数据的可视化设计是指对数据进行可视化的设计,选择合适的图表类型和颜色;数据的可视化呈现是指将设计好的图表进行展示,使用户可以直观地查看和分析数据。
在数据展示的过程中,数据的可视化设计是关键的一步。数据的可视化设计需要考虑数据的类型和特点,选择合适的图表类型和颜色。例如,对于时间序列数据,可以选择折线图或者柱状图;对于分类数据,可以选择饼图或者条形图。通过合理的可视化设计,可以使数据更加直观和易于理解。
数据的可视化呈现是数据展示的最后一步。数据的可视化呈现可以通过仪表盘、报表等方式进行展示。FineBI、FineReport、FineVis等可视化工具可以提供丰富的可视化组件和模板,帮助用户快速实现数据的可视化呈现。通过这些工具,用户可以轻松地创建各种图表和仪表盘,实现对数据的直观展示和分析。
四、FineBI、FineReport、FineVis的应用
FineBI、FineReport、FineVis是帆软旗下的三款重要的数据可视化工具,分别针对不同的应用场景和需求。
FineBI:FineBI是一款专业的商业智能分析工具,主要用于数据的自助分析和展示。FineBI支持多种数据源的接入,可以实现数据的自动化整合和分析。用户可以通过拖拽操作,轻松创建各种图表和仪表盘,实现对数据的自助分析。FineBI还支持多种数据挖掘算法,可以帮助用户发现数据中的隐藏规律和趋势。FineBI官网: https://s.fanruan.com/f459r
FineReport:FineReport是一款专业的报表工具,主要用于数据的报表设计和展示。FineReport支持多种数据源的接入,可以实现数据的自动化整合和展示。用户可以通过拖拽操作,轻松创建各种报表和图表,实现对数据的直观展示。FineReport还支持多种报表模板和样式,可以帮助用户快速创建各种类型的报表。FineReport官网: https://s.fanruan.com/ryhzq
FineVis:FineVis是一款专业的数据可视化工具,主要用于数据的可视化设计和展示。FineVis支持多种数据源的接入,可以实现数据的自动化整合和展示。用户可以通过拖拽操作,轻松创建各种图表和仪表盘,实现对数据的直观展示。FineVis还支持多种可视化模板和样式,可以帮助用户快速创建各种类型的图表和仪表盘。FineVis官网: https://s.fanruan.com/7z296
五、异构数据可视化技术的挑战和解决方案
在实际应用中,异构数据可视化技术面临着多种挑战,包括数据的多样性、数据的质量、数据的安全性等。
数据的多样性:不同的数据源使用不同的数据模型和存储格式,给数据的整合和分析带来了很大的困难。为了解决这个问题,可以使用ETL工具来进行数据的抽取、转换和加载,实现对异构数据的整合和标准化。
数据的质量:数据的质量直接影响到数据分析的结果和决策的准确性。为了解决这个问题,可以使用数据清洗工具对数据进行清理,去除重复数据、错误数据和无效数据,提高数据的准确性和可靠性。
数据的安全性:数据的安全性是数据可视化技术的一个重要问题。为了解决这个问题,可以采用数据加密、数据访问控制等技术,保证数据的安全性和隐私性。
六、异构数据可视化技术的未来发展趋势
随着大数据和人工智能技术的发展,异构数据可视化技术也在不断发展和进步。未来,异构数据可视化技术将呈现以下发展趋势:
智能化:随着人工智能技术的发展,数据可视化将变得更加智能化。通过引入机器学习和深度学习算法,可以实现对数据的自动化分析和可视化设计,帮助用户发现数据中的隐藏规律和趋势。
实时化:随着物联网和大数据技术的发展,实时数据的需求越来越高。未来,数据可视化技术将更加注重实时数据的展示和分析,实现对实时数据的可视化和决策支持。
交互性:随着用户需求的不断变化,数据可视化将变得更加交互化。通过引入交互式图表和仪表盘,可以实现对数据的动态展示和分析,帮助用户更好地理解和利用数据。
多样化:随着数据源的不断增加,数据可视化技术将变得更加多样化。未来,数据可视化技术将支持更多的数据源和数据格式,实现对异构数据的全面整合和展示。
总之,异构数据可视化技术是一种将来自不同来源、格式和类型的数据进行统一展示的方法,通过数据整合、数据转换和数据展示,可以实现对数据的直观展示和分析。FineBI、FineReport、FineVis是帆软旗下的三款重要的数据可视化工具,分别针对不同的应用场景和需求。在实际应用中,异构数据可视化技术面临着多种挑战,但通过合理的技术手段,可以有效地解决这些问题。未来,随着大数据和人工智能技术的发展,异构数据可视化技术将呈现出智能化、实时化、交互性和多样化的发展趋势。
相关问答FAQs:
什么是异构数据可视化技术?
异构数据可视化技术是一种数据可视化技术,用于处理不同来源、结构和类型的数据。这种技术可以将来自多个数据源的数据整合在一起,并以易于理解和分析的方式呈现出来。异构数据可视化技术的主要目的是帮助用户更好地理解数据,发现数据之间的关联和模式,以便做出更明智的决策。
为什么需要使用异构数据可视化技术?
随着数据量的不断增加和数据来源的多样化,传统的数据可视化技术已经无法满足用户对复杂数据分析的需求。异构数据可视化技术可以帮助用户在面对来自不同数据源的数据时更好地进行分析和挖掘,从而更全面地了解数据背后的含义和价值。通过使用异构数据可视化技术,用户可以更深入地挖掘数据之间的联系,发现隐藏在数据中的有价值信息,并做出更准确的决策。
异构数据可视化技术有哪些应用场景?
异构数据可视化技术在各个领域都有广泛的应用。比如,在金融领域,银行可以利用异构数据可视化技术来分析客户的交易数据、信用评分数据和行为数据,从而更好地了解客户的需求和风险。在医疗领域,医院可以将来自不同医疗设备的数据整合在一起,利用异构数据可视化技术来监测患者的健康状况和疾病发展趋势。在市场营销领域,企业可以结合来自社交媒体、网站流量和销售数据的异构数据,通过数据可视化技术来识别潜在客户群体和市场趋势。这些都是异构数据可视化技术的典型应用场景,显示了其在不同领域中的重要性和价值。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。